ZIP Code 30363

ZIP / ZCTA

Population: 3,762

ZIP Code Tabulation Areas (ZCTAs) are Census approximations of USPS ZIP codes. Boundaries may differ slightly from postal delivery areas, and estimates for less-populated ZCTAs carry higher margins of error.

Data: U.S. Census Bureau, ACS 5-Year Estimates, 2023 (released December 2024).

Quick Facts — 30363

What is the median household income in 30363?
The median household income in 30363 is $107,604 (U.S. Census Bureau ACS 5-Year Estimates, 2023).
What is the poverty rate in 30363?
The poverty rate in 30363 is 0.0% (U.S. Census Bureau ACS 2023).
What is the median home value in 30363?
$386,800 (U.S. Census Bureau ACS 2023).
What is the average rent in 30363?
The median gross rent in 30363 is $2,001 per month (U.S. Census Bureau ACS 2023).
What percentage of 30363 residents have a college degree?
92.2% of adults in 30363 hold a bachelor's degree or higher (U.S. Census Bureau ACS 2023).
